What companies run services between Oliveira de Azeméis (Station), Portugal and Porto, Portugal?

UNIR Mobilidade operates a bus from Oliveira de Azeméis - Praça José da Costa to Porto - Parque das Camélias 4 times a day. Tickets cost €1–9 and the journey takes 55 min. Alternatively, Comboios de Portugal operates a train from Oliveira De Azemeis to Espinho - Vouga hourly. Tickets cost €3–7 and the journey takes 1h 3m.
